Don't know how long you'll be in SP.

I've made the calculation a couple of times...usually spent over a month there. Easier to just rent long term. Rental bikes come with a basket and perhaps a child seat....this makes it easier to haul stuff...if you don't have a kid. Having a basket installed should be a hassle on a newly purchased bike. Also rental company provided maintenance weekly or bi-weekly....usually more oil on the chain.


Another option is to buy a used bike from the rental store. They're constantly changing their rental fleet.

If I remember correctly..a rental is BZE 50 per week and a new bike is BZE 250.
